How much does it cost to rent a home in Anguilla?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Anguilla 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$848 | $600 | $1,000 |
Anguilla 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,586 | $775 | $3,200 |
Anguilla 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,840 | $1,195 | $2,875 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Anguilla
What type of rentals are currently available in Anguilla?
There are currently 39 Apartments for Rent in Anguilla, MS with pricing that ranges from $306 to $3,185. There are also 34 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Anguilla ranging from $600 to $3,200.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Anguilla?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Anguilla ranges from $600 to $3,200 with an average monthly rent of $1,256.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Anguilla?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Anguilla range from $740 to $3,185,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$775 to $3,200.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,195 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$950.
